WebJan 3, 2024 · 7.3: Oxidative Phosphorylation. Oxidative phosphorylation is the mechanism that by which ATP captures the free energy in the mitochondrial proton gradient. Most of the ATP made in aerobic organisms is made by oxidative phosphorylation, rather than by substrate phosphorylation (the mechanism of ATP synthesis in glycolysis or the Krebs … Weboxidative phosphorylation and can work in reverse as a proton pumping ATPase. Oxidative phosphorylation is a process in which ATP is synthesized as a result of transfer of electrons from NADH and FADH2 to oxygen.
